According to a report from Matt Zenitz, Jim Harbaugh is expected to bring back a familiar face to the Michigan football program for the 2023 season. Zenitz reported on Monday that the Wolverines are expected to hire Chris Partridge as an assistant coach. Partridge, who was the defensive coordinator for Ole Miss in 2022, coached with the Wolverines from 2015-2019.

Why it Matters for Michigan and Chris Partridge
This is a huge hire for Harbaugh as Partridge was considered one of the top recruiters in the nation during his time with the Wolverines. During his first stint in Ann Arbor, Partridge was a director of player personnel, while also coaching the safeties and special teams. Over the past eight recruitment cycles, Partridge was either a lead or secondary recruiter for 38 four- or five-star recruits who joined Michigan or Ole Miss.
